Benefits of Cat Doors

Before we dive into the details of working with a cat door contractor, let's explore the benefits of setting up a cat door:

  • Convenience: A cat door provides your cat with the flexibility to come and go as they please, without the requirement for consistent guidance.
  • Exercise: Outdoor access permits your cat to participate in physical activity, such as running, leaping, and exploring, which is important for their general health and wellness.
  • Psychological Stimulation: Exposure to the outdoors supplies mental stimulation, reducing tension and dullness.
  • Easy Access: A cat door removes the requirement for regular journeys to the door, allowing you to unwind while your cat delights in the outdoors.

What to Look for in a Cat Door Contractor

When employing a cat door contractor, there are numerous aspects to consider:

  • Experience: Look for a contractor with experience in setting up cat doors, as they'll recognize with the specific requirements and challenges.
  • Reputation: Check online reviews, ask for recommendations, and validate licenses and accreditations to guarantee the contractor has a good credibility.
  • Insurance coverage: Make sure the contractor has liability insurance and workers' compensation insurance coverage to protect you and their workers.
  • Equipment: Ensure the contractor has the required equipment and tools to complete the task.

Preparing for the Installation Process

To guarantee a smooth installation process, follow these steps:

  1. Measure the Door: Measure the door where you want to set up the cat door to ensure it's the right size.
  2. Select the Right Material: Select a cat door that matches your door's material, such as wood or metal.
  3. Clear the Area: Clear the surrounding area of any debris or obstructions to provide the contractor a clean workspace.
  4. Arrange a Time: Schedule a time that works for you and the contractor, guaranteeing very little disruption to your everyday routine.

Q: How much does it cost to work with a cat door contractor?A: The cost of employing a cat door contractor differs depending on the place, size of the door, and products utilized. Usually, the cost varieties from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500.

Q: How long does it take to set up a cat door?A: The installation process typically takes 1-3 hours, depending on the complexity of the job.
